WebApr 7, 2024 · An employer is required to begin withholding Additional Medicare Tax in the pay period in which it pays wages in excess of $200,000 to an employee and continue to withhold it each pay period until the end of the calendar year. WebFeb 16, 2024 · Additional Medicare tax begins at earnings of: [10] $250,000 for Married filing jointly $200,000 for Single, Head of household, or Qualifying Widow (er) $125,000 for Married filing separately 4 Add your payroll and income taxes to get your total withholding.
WebNov 2, 2024 · The Medicare tax for self-employed individuals is 2.9% to cover both the employee's and employer's portions. WebJun 29, 2024 · The standard Medicare tax is 1.45 percent, or 2.9 percent if you’re self-employed. Taxpayers who earn above $200,000, or $250,000 for married couples, will pay an additional 0.9 percent toward...
WebNov 12, 2024 · Medicare Part A Premium and Deductible. Medicare Part A covers inpatient hospital, skilled nursing facility, hospice, inpatient rehabilitation, and some home health care services. The rate is 15.3% as of 2024, of which 12.4% goes to Social Security and 2.9% goes to Medicare. This tax is shared by their employers.
